NID's Outreach Programmes bring the Institute's experience and training facilities to the service of those outside its regular education and client service activities.
These Programmes help build a network of design collaboration toward economic and social priorities, between the Institute and organisation, groups and individuals all over India. These networks help extend design application in many areas still new to design.
NID's efforts are enriched by the experience of its Outreach collaborators which range from industrial bodies (particularly small, medium and hand industries) and other institutions of education and training, to voluntary organisation and central or state bodies working in priority sectors.
Workshop and training programmes are tailored to the specific needs of particular groups, aimed at assisting them to put design awareness in schools, at primary and secondary levels.
Among the ongoing outreach programmes a few are listed below:
-
Strategic Design Intervention for the Development of the Handloom Weavers in the State of Tamil Nadu for Commissioner of Handlooms & Textiles, Government of Tamil Nadu.
- Design & Technology Development Training workshops for Leather Development for Department of Industrial Policy and Promotion, New Delhi and Central Leather Research Institute, Chennai.
- Preparation of Detail Project Report for setting up a Jharkhand Handicrafts resource-cum-Research Development Institute at Ranchi for Department of Industries, Govt. of Jharkhand.
- Implementation of Handloom Export Scheme Design Innovation & Product Diversification for Sree Bhagwathy Handloom Weaver’s Society Ltd, Kerala and Sree Vellayani Handloom Weaver’s Society Ltd, Kerala.
- Development of innovative range of Furniture’s in Living Room, Kitchen, Bed Room and Office Furniture out of Coir for the Coir Board of India, Bangalore
